Bobotie - Traditional
Bobotie is South Africa’s favourite national dish – spiced minced meat with an egg topping.
Ingredients:
(4 - 6 servings) 1 kg minced beef or lamb 2 onions 25 ml oil 2 slices white bread 50 g apricots 50 g sultanas or raisins 40 g almonds 15 ml parsley chopped 250ml Bobotie Sauce (Rainbow Cuisine) Salt and pepper 2 bay leaves Topping: 2 eggs 250 ml milk Salt Accompaniment: Date and Tomato Chutney (Rainbow Cuisine) Boiled rice seasoned with turmeric and cinnamon
Method:
1. Chop onions and fry in oil until translucent. Add meat and fry for another 5 min. 2. Transfer onion and meat to a bowl. Mix with bread, apricots, sultanas, almonds, parsley and Bobotie Sauce. Mix well and season with salt. 3. Transfer mixture to an ovenproof dish. Flatten and insert bay leaves into the mince. 4. Bake in a preheated oven at 180 C for 30 min. Remove from the oven. 5. Mix together milk and eggs. Season with salt. Pour over the mince. 6. Raise temperature to 200 C and bake again until the egg mixture is firm and golden (approx 15 min). Serving: Serve in the ovenproof dish or cut into portions. Serve with rice cooked with turmeric and cinnamon together with Date & Tomato Chutney (Rainbow Cuisine). Crème Fraiche or creamy yoghurt also goes well with this dish.
